Origin & Story
Piper nigrum
White Penja pepper comes from the volcanic highlands of Cameroon, more precisely from the valley of Penja in the Moungo region. There the pepper plants grow on mineral-rich soils in a tropical climate – ideal conditions for particularly aromatic fruit. Penja pepper was the first African spice with a protected designation of origin. The berries are harvested only when fully ripe, then fermented, peeled and traditionally sun-dried.
Highlights
Compared to black pepper, white Penja is softer and rounder in flavour. Its heat is precise but never aggressive – carried by cool, mineral notes and a trace of menthol. Typical is a long, delicately spicy finish with a light creaminess. It is ideal for light dishes where elegance and restraint are called for.
Quality
Our peppercorns come from the careful handwork of small farms around Penja. The ripe pepper berries are fermented, peeled and gently sun-dried – no additives, no industrial bleaching. The result is a pure natural product with high aromatic density and consistent quality.
